As of March 2025, pre-exposure prophylaxis, or PrEP, services were completely halted in Haiti except for pregnant and lactating women. HIV prevention communication and community engagement strategies also abruptly ended.

Additional Context: At this time, the Haitian National HIV program estimated a monthly rise of 30 to 50% in new HIV infections due to the absence of communication and prevention activities.
Devex Researcher Note: National HIV response in Haiti was “almost entirely reliant on PEPFAR”, which provided about 90% of HIV funding and covered 80% of PrEP plans nationwide.
